    • When sensors are employed to monitor different operating variables or parameters in a refrigeration system, the sensor outputs will normally have predetermined known relationships with respect to each other as long as the sensors are functioning properly and regardless of the operating condition of the refrigeration system. By comparing the output of one sensor relative to that of another sensor, a faulty condition of either of those two sensors may be detected. For example, during stabilized system operation the output of a condenser pressure sensor should always indicate a higher pressure than that reflected by the output of an evaporator pressure sensor. By effectively subtracting the evaporator pressure from the condenser pressure, a faulty sensor may be discovered. If the result of the subtraction is zero or negative, at least one of the pressure sensors is defective. When a faulty sensor is detected, a warning message is displayed to operating personnel.

    • A jack assembly for use in raising and lowering large platforms on columns, caissons and the like, having upper and lower annular portions interconnected by hydraulic motor means for relative vertical movement therebetween and a plurality of arcuate pneumatically operated gripper assemblies in both the upper and lower portions of the jack; each of the gripper assemblies being removably replaceable from its position in the jack assembly without removal of the jack assembly from the caisson which it surrounds.
